Magellan Asset Management Ltd bought a new position in OGE Energy Corporation (NYSE:OGE – Free Report) in the second qu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und bought 231,574 shares of the utilities provider’s stock, valued at approximately $11,268,000.
Other institutional investors and hedge funds have also recently modified their holdings of the company. Greenland Capital Management LP bought a new stake in shares of OGE Energy in the 2nd quarter valued at $3,635,000. Commerce Bank bought a new position in OGE Energy during the second quarter worth $2,009,000. Northwestern Mutual Wealth Management Co. bought a new position in OGE Energy during the second quarter worth $598,000. Evolve Private Wealth LLC acquired a new stake in OGE Energy in the second quarter worth $298,000. Finally, Emerald Investment Advisers LLC bought a new stake in OGE Energy in the second quarter valued at $4,751,000. 71.84% of the stock is currently owned by institutional investors.

OGE Energy Trading Up 0.1%
NYSE:OGE opened at $45.67 on Monday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.12, a current ratio of 0.77 and a quick ratio of 0.47. OGE Energy Corporation has a one year low of $41.69 and a one year high of $50.59. The company has a market cap of $9.43 billion, a PE ratio of 20.12, a PEG ratio of 3.38 and a beta of 0.53.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$48.08 and a 200-day moving average of $47.69.
OGE Energy (NYSE:OGE –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 28th. The utilities provider reported $0.56 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.55 by $0.01. The business had revenue of $711.90 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$782.73 million. OGE Energy had a net margin of 14.44% and a return on equity of 9.48%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was down 4.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$0.53 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ts expect that OGE Energy Corporation will post 2.42 EPS for the current fiscal year.
OGE Energy Profile
OGE Energy Corp. (NYSE:OGE) is an energy and infrastructure holding company headquartered in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. Through its principal subsidiary, Oklahoma Gas & Electric Company, the company provides regulated electric service to residential, commercial and industrial customers across Oklahoma and western Arkansas. Its diversified generation mix includes coal, natural gas and wind-powered facilities, complemented by ongoing investments in grid modernization and smart technology to enhance reliability and customer satisfaction.
